Bukit Lawang Riverside

This is the most well-known and bustling area of Bohorok, serving as the primary gateway to the Gunung Leuser National Park and its famous orangutan trekking opportunities. The vibe here is energetic and adventurous, with a constant flow of travellers from around the globe, particularly from Europe and North America, drawn by the promise of jungle exploration. You'll find a lively atmosphere along the riverbanks, with guesthouses, restaurants, and tour operators catering to the influx of nature enthusiasts eager to experience Sumatra Jungle Tours and the iconic BLUE SKY BUKIT LAWANG.

From a practical standpoint, Bukit Lawang Riverside is where most tourist amenities are concentrated. Accommodation ranges from budget-friendly guesthouses to more comfortable lodges, many offering direct access to the Bohorok River. This area is ideal for those who want to be at the heart of the action, with easy access to guides for jungle treks, tubing excursions, and local eateries serving Indonesian specialties. Getting here typically involves a journey from Medan's Kualanamu International Airport (KNO), followed by a local transfer to the riverside. What to Eat and Where to Find It in Bohorok

Bohorok's culinary landscape is a vibrant reflection of Indonesian flavours, offering a delightful array of dishes that showcase the region's fresh ingredients and diverse culinary heritage. While the area is renowned for its proximity to the jungle, its food scene is equally captivating. Travellers can expect to savour authentic Sumatran cuisine, characterized by its bold spices, aromatic herbs, and a delightful balance of sweet, sour, and savoury notes. From hearty rice dishes to flavourful noodle soups and grilled specialties, Bohorok promises a gastronomic journey that complements its natural wonders.

The best places to experience Bohorok's food are often found in the bustling areas of Bukit Lawang, particularly along the riverside and in the village centre. Here, local warungs (small, informal eateries) and restaurants serve up a variety of Indonesian favourites. For Muslim travellers, finding Halal-certified eateries is generally straightforward, as Indonesia is a predominantly Muslim country, and most establishments adhere to Halal practices. Look for signs indicating Halal preparation or ask locals for recommendations to ensure your dining experiences align with your dietary needs.

For international visitors, the cost of dining in Bohorok offers excellent value. Street food and meals at local warungs can range from as little as ₱ 50 to ₱ 150 (approximately $1–$3 USD), providing an affordable way to sample local delicacies. Mid-range restaurants typically charge between ₱ 200 to ₱ 500 (approximately $4–$10 USD) for a main course, offering a more comfortable dining experience. Even more upscale establishments remain reasonably priced compared to Western standards, allowing travellers to enjoy diverse culinary experiences without significant financial strain.

When dining in Bohorok, embracing local customs enhances the experience. It's common to eat with your right hand, especially at more informal settings, though utensils are readily available. Tipping is not mandatory but is appreciated for excellent service, with a small amount (around 10%) being customary. Meal times are generally flexible, with breakfast, lunch, and dinner being the main occasions. Be open to trying new flavours and don't hesitate to ask for recommendations; the warmth of Indonesian hospitality often extends to sharing their culinary traditions.

Cultural Norms and Staying Safe in Bohorok

Understanding and respecting local customs is paramount for a smooth and enriching visit to Bohorok. While generally a welcoming region, awareness of certain cultural nuances can prevent misunderstandings. For instance, it's customary to dress modestly when visiting villages or religious sites, covering shoulders and knees. Public displays of affection should be kept to a minimum. When interacting with locals, a polite greeting and a smile go a long way. It's also considered polite to use your right hand for giving and receiving items, as the left hand is sometimes associated with personal hygiene.

When visiting popular sites like Sumatra Jungle Tours or the area around BLUE SKY BUKIT LAWANG, maintaining respectful behaviour is key. While these are tourist-oriented, they are still within a cultural context. Dress code is generally casual for trekking, but avoid overly revealing clothing. Photography is usually permitted, but it's always courteous to ask permission before taking close-up photos of people. Be mindful of noise levels, especially in natural settings, to avoid disturbing wildlife or other visitors. Queueing is not always as formal as in Western countries, so patience and observation are useful.

Safety in Bohorok is generally good, especially in tourist areas like Bukit Lawang, but standard precautions should always be taken. Keep your valuables secure and be aware of your surroundings, particularly in crowded markets or during transfers. While ride-hailing apps like Grab are available in some parts of Indonesia, their presence and reliability in more remote areas like Bohorok can vary; local taxis and motorbike taxis (ojek) are common and usually affordable, but agree on the fare beforehand. For navigation, offline map applications are highly recommended, as mobile signal can be intermittent in jungle areas.

In case of emergencies, local police numbers are available, and tourist information centres can assist with immediate concerns. For Filipino travellers, it's advisable to have the contact details for the Philippine Embassy or Consulate in Indonesia readily accessible. While there might not be a dedicated tourist police force in Bohorok, local authorities are generally helpful. It's also wise to have comprehensive travel insurance that covers medical emergencies and potential adventure activities, and to consult the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) for any travel advisories before your departure.

Getting to Bohorok and Getting Around

Reaching Bohorok from the Philippines involves a journey that typically requires at least one connecting flight. Travellers departing from Manila (NAIA/MNL), Cebu (CEB), or other major Philippine hubs will usually find flights to Kualanamu International Airport (KNO) near Medan, North Sumatra, Indonesia. Direct flights are uncommon, so expect layovers in hubs like Kuala Lumpur, Singapore, or Jakarta. The total travel time, including layovers, can range from 8 to 15 hours or more, with flight prices varying significantly based on the season and booking time, but generally falling within the ₱ 15,000 to ₱ 30,000 range for a round trip. From KNO, you will need to arrange onward transport to Bohorok.

Once you arrive at Kualanamu International Airport (KNO), the journey to Bohorok, specifically the popular Bukit Lawang area, typically takes around 4 to 5 hours by car or minivan. Many accommodations in Bukit Lawang offer airport transfer services, which can be a convenient option for international travellers, especially after a long flight. Alternatively, you can take a taxi or a pre-booked private car to the Bohorok bus terminal in Medan, and then catch a local bus or shared minivan to Bukit Lawang. Within Bukit Lawang itself, getting around is best done on foot, as the main tourist area is quite compact, or by using local ojek (motorbike taxis) for short distances.

The best time to visit Bohorok for international travellers generally falls within the dry seasons, from March to October. During these months, the weather is typically more favourable for jungle trekking and outdoor activities, with less rainfall. However, Bohorok experiences a tropical climate year-round, meaning occasional rain showers are always possible. The peak tourist season often coincides with European and North American summer holidays, from June to August, and around Christmas and New Year. Visiting during the shoulder seasons, such as March-May or September-October, can offer a good balance of pleasant weather and fewer crowds, potentially with slightly lower accommodation prices.

Before you depart for Bohorok, a few pre-departure preparations are essential. Ensure your Philippine passport is valid for at least six months beyond your intended stay in Indonesia. The local currency is the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R), but it's advisable to carry some US Dollars in cash for initial expenses or emergencies, as USD is widely accepted for currency exchange. You can purchase a local SIM card at the airport upon arrival for affordable data and calls. Essential apps to download include offline maps (like Maps.me or Google Maps with downloaded areas), a translation app, and potentially a ride-hailing app if available in the region. Visa Information

For Philippine passport holders planning a trip to Bohorok, Indonesia, understanding the visa requirements is crucial. As of current regulations, Philippine citizens are generally granted visa-free entry into Indonesia for short stays, typically up to 30 days, for tourism purposes. This allows for a convenient entry into the country, meaning you do not need to apply for a visa in advance through an embassy or consulate. However, it is imperative to ensure your passport has at least six months of validity remaining from your date of entry into Indonesia and that you possess proof of onward travel, such as a return or onward flight ticket.

The process for entering Indonesia with a visa-free status is straightforward upon arrival at the international airport. Immigration officers will typically stamp your passport with the entry date and the permitted duration of stay. While visa-free entry is common, it is always recommended to double-check the latest regulations with the Indonesian Embassy or Consulate in the Philippines or their official immigration website before your travel dates, as policies can change. Ensure you have sufficient funds to cover your stay, as immigration officials may request proof of financial means.

While visa-free entry simplifies the process for Philippine passport holders, it is essential to adhere to the terms of your stay. Overstaying your visa-free period can result in fines, detention, or deportation. If your travel plans extend beyond the permitted duration, you will need to apply for the appropriate visa in advance. Always confirm the most current visa policies and any specific requirements directly with Indonesian immigration authorities or their official representatives to ensure a smooth and compliant entry into Indonesia for your visit to Bohorok.
